Understanding LTL Trucking: What It Is and Why It Matters
LTL trucking is a segment of freight shipping that specializes in consolidating multiple smaller shipments into one truck. This technique allows businesses to optimize costs and improve efficiency. Here’s why LTL trucking matters:
- Cost Efficiency: By sharing truck space with other shippers, businesses can save significantly on shipping costs.
- Flexibility: LTL services offer flexible shipping times and routes, catering to the specific needs of businesses.
- Environmental Sustainability: Consolidating shipments reduces the number of trucks on the road, leading to lower carbon emissions.

Key Features of LTL Trucking Services
When evaluating LTL trucking companies, it's crucial to understand the key features they offer:
- Freight Classifications: LTL carriers utilize a classification system to categorize shipments based on weight, dimensions, and density, affecting pricing.
- Terminal Facilities: LTL providers typically maintain a network of terminals that facilitate the efficient transfer of freight, ensuring timely deliveries.
- Specialized Services: Many LTL companies offer specialized services such as refrigerated transport, hazardous materials handling, and white-glove services for delicate or high-value items.

Best Practices for Shipping with LTL Carriers
Successful shipping using LTL carriers requires some preparation. Here are some best practices:
- Proper Packaging: Ensure your products are packaged securely to prevent damage during transport.
- Accurate Weight and Dimensions: Provide precise measurements for your shipment, as inaccuracies can lead to higher fees.
- Clear Labels: Use clear and precise labels on all packages, indicating handling instructions and destination information.
